Use the distributive property to write an expression that is equivalent to: 3(x + 5)

Answer:

3x + 15

Explanation:

when distributing, multiply the number outside of the parentheses by the numbers inside the parentheses.

3(x + 5)


DISTRIBUTE 3 WITHIN the PARENTHESES

= 3(x) + 3(5)


= 3x + 15
